Friends and family will honor Macon music community member David Jarrell—known for his support of local bands—with a benefit on Sunday at 1 p.m. at Society Garden in Ingleside Village to help cover his end-of-life expenses after his burial on Tuesday in Warner Robins.
A Twiggs County couple reunited with their daughter after a three-week search — spanning nearly 600 square miles — ended when she was found in a remote mountain cabin near Lake Edison in California.
Her parents said they were grateful and authorities confirmed she was in good condition after she received treatment for dehydration.
Walgreens will permanently close its Macon store on Mercer University Drive at noon on May 21 as part of a plan to cut costs—1,200 stores are set to close over the next three years.
Customers are advised to use alternative locations on Vineville Avenue and Zebulon Road for their prescriptions.
Macon will host a variety of arts events this weekend; today, the Macon Arts Alliance celebrates its 40th anniversary at Mill Hill Community Arts Center with music and art, and Sunday brings free dance recitals at Piedmont Grand Opera House, a 4 p.m. choral concert at Mercer University, a 1 p.m. tribute jam at Society Garden, final theater shows, and Bike Walk Macon events + more for local art lovers.
